sorry you misunderstood me
i mean that there is aphase detector of 2 inputs beside the output of the VCO
i know that apll compares acertain input frequency with the frequency of vco and the diffrence or error is amplified and filterd so as to be applied as an input to the vco
so on;y one input exists with the output of vco
but i saw ics which have 2 inputs beside the feed back signal and i dont know what is it ?

The 4030 MOSFET quad 2-input exclusive OR can be used as a digital PLL phase detector. See

http://www.datasheetcatalog.org/datasheets/208/206742_DS.pdf

Also look up the NE565 PLL chip, which is a classic PLL chip
